    When contemplating the various ways that the surging Carolina Hurricanes could bury the slumping Washington Capitals, a shutout by Justin Peters would not be anywhere near the top of the list.

    Sure enough, it happened Tuesday night.

    Called up to the big club last week after Cam Ward went down with a knee injury, Peters made 26 saves as the Hurricanes blanked the Capitals 4-0, taking the first leg of a key home-and-home series between the Southeast Division rivals.
